原文:getMeasuredHeight(),getScrollY(),getHeight()的區別和聯系

前言:關於控件的高度有兩種獲取方式,一個是獲得控件的實際大小 getMeasuredHeight ,就是包含顯示部分和已顯示的部分 而getHeight是獲得控件的顯示的大小,如果控件大小超出的屏幕,那他的大小就是屏幕的大小。 這句話有待商榷 .測試:使用的ScrollView控件,里面是一個LinearLayout,很長方便測試。 啟動時的數據: .滑動一點: .滑動到底部: 說明:其中的Sc ...

2013-07-12 19:08 1 3280 推薦指數:

查看詳情

getMeasuredHeight()與getHeight() 以及MeasureSpec.getSize()

getMeasuredHeight()返回的是原始測量高度,與屏幕無關,getHeight()返回的是在屏幕上顯示的高度。實際上在當屏幕可以包裹內容的時候,他們的值是相等的,只有當view超出屏幕后,才能看出他們的區別。當超出屏幕后,getMeasuredHeight()等於getHeight ...

Fri Oct 28 00:16:00 CST 2016 0 4178
進程與線程的區別聯系,與作業的區別聯系

進程的定義:   進程是具有獨立功能的程序關於某個數據集合上的一次運行活動,是系統資源分配、調度和保護的獨立單位。   進程是為了描述程序在並發執行時對系統資源的共享,所需的一個描述程序執行時的動 ...

Sun Dec 15 04:44:00 CST 2019 0 303
Python與R的區別聯系

轉自:http://bbs.pinggu.org/thread-3078817-1-1.html 有人說Python和R的區別是顯而易見的,因為R是針對統計的,python是給程序員設計的,其實這話對Python多多少少有些不公平。2012年的時候我們說R是學術界的主流,但是現在 ...

Tue Feb 28 17:33:00 CST 2017 0 1970
堆和棧的區別聯系

堆和棧概要   在計算機領域,堆棧是一個不容忽視的概念,堆棧是兩種數據結構。堆棧都是一種數據項按序排列的數據結構,只能在一端(稱為棧頂(top))對數據項進行插入和刪除。在單片機應用中,堆棧是個特殊 ...

Wed Jul 08 22:56:00 CST 2020 0 766
IDispose和Finalize的區別聯系

今天看代碼,看到IDispose然后牽涉到垃圾回收機制,最后又到Finalize折騰了一下午,現在終於了解.NET的一些運行機制了。 看到GC.SuppressFinalize方法(MSDN:htt ...

Thu Mar 08 01:02:00 CST 2012 2 2647
JSP和Servlet的區別聯系

JSP和Servlet jsp和servlet的區別、共同點、各自應用的范圍? JSP是Servlet技術的擴展,本質上就是Servlet的簡易方式。JSP編譯后是“類servlet”。 Servlet和JSP最主要的不同點在於,Servlet的應用邏輯是在Java文件中,並且完全從表示層中 ...

Tue Jun 04 07:20:00 CST 2019 0 1871
進程和線程的區別聯系

聯系:1、線程是進程的最小執行和分配單元,不能獨立運動,必須依賴於進程,這也就可以說眾多的線程組成了進程    2、同一個進程中的線程是共享內存資源的,比如全局變量,每一個線程都可以改變其共同進程中的全局變量的數據 區別:1、進程是程序在系統上進行順序執行的動態活動。程序加載到內存,系統 ...

Fri Mar 15 17:19:00 CST 2019 1 573
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M